The Saxapahaw General Store as it now exists began in June 2008 when Jeff Barney, butcher and self-taught cook, and Cameron Ratliff, teacher and self-taught biscuit maker, worked with former owner Mac Jordan to begin a new life for the convenience store and gas station that had served the community for several years.
They imagined a spot where a village could gather for refreshments, meals, and basic home provisions, run by folks whose varied backgrounds have each taught them they can influence their world by collaborating with their neighbors.
They hoped to serve the residents of Saxapahaw with a range of products that could allow everyone to feel welcome.
They decided to become stewards of local foods, good wine and beer, nutritious snacks, and eco-conscious dry goods.
Now joined by a thoughtful and vital staff, these images have become their mission, and they hope you will find them striving toward that goal when you visit the store.
